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
539535128 3959741791 6164696418 28731 687383617
302746364 85846439
302746364 85846439
684 48677634459 74378
All about undefined
Interested in learning more?
302746364 85846439
684 48677634459 74378
See more
9620414 2196 64765616
5130 3222471 2525068036
See more
4757536 550764 320365982
49152513104 812760 90509872 05553308
See more